Mahabharata Drona Parva – तम अन्ये शूरसेनानां शूराः संख्ये नयवारयन

Shloka (श्लोक)
तम अन्ये शूरसेनानां शूराः संख्ये नयवारयन
नियच्छन्तः शरव्रातैर मत्तं दविपम इवाङ्कुशैः
⚡ Quick Meaning
In battle, the warriors of Shurasena restrained the mighty elephant-like force with their arrows.
Translations
English Translation
The warriors of the Shurasena clan engaged fiercely in battle, skillfully restraining the formidable force akin to a massive elephant using their arrows like a goad. This demonstrates the valor and prowess of the warriors in the face of overwhelming challenges.

Commentary
Context
This verse highlights a moment during the Drona Parva of the Mahabharata when warriors demonstrate their valiant efforts in restraining powerful foes.
Meaning
The imagery of an elephant signifies immense strength and the valor of warriors representing formidable combat capabilities and strategic prowess.
